Step-by-Step: Making Iced Cold Brew at Home
1. Choose Your Coffee
Go for freshly roasted, coarsely ground beans—single-origin and medium roasts from Mug & Meadow Co. deliver rich, complex flavors perfect for cold brew extraction.
2. Pick an Eco-Friendly Brewer
Sustainability is key: Choose reusable cold brew makers, glass mason jars, or compostable filter bags. New all-in-one systems for 2025 make cleanup and filtration easy without plastics or waste.
3. The Perfect Ratio
Mix 1 cup of coarse coffee grounds with 4 cups of cold, filtered water. Stir gently.
4. Steep Slow, Awake Bold
Steep the mixture in the fridge for 12–18 hours. Longer extraction brings out deeper notes—taste test after 12 hours and adjust for your favorite intensity.
5. Strain and Serve
Use a fine mesh strainer or sustainable coffee filter to separate the grounds. Serve with ice for classic cold brew or shake things up with the following creative add-ins.
Trending Cold Brew Recipes & Infusions (2025)
-
Maple Cinnamon Twist: Add a splash of pure maple syrup and a dusting of Ceylon cinnamon.
-
Oat Milk Vanilla Cold Brew: Swirl in oat milk and a dash of vanilla extract.
-
Superfood Boost: Stir in a pinch of mushroom powder (like lion’s mane or chaga) for a nutritious upgrade.
-
Citrus Spritz: Add an orange peel or dash of lemon zest while steeping for a bright, natural infusion.
Pro Tips for Next-Level Iced Coffee
-
Use large, slow-melting ice cubes to avoid dilution.
-
Store cold brew in an airtight glass jar—freshness can last up to a week.
